In order to establish and maintain collaboration during Individualized Education Program (IEP) meetings, Cheryl and Ken receive the IEP ahead of time for review and suggestions on what goals to add, change, or delete for Jake. This allows Cheryl and Ken to feel active and involved in their son’s education. The school also allows Jake’s in-home therapist to attend these meetings as well so that all professionals can be involved and working as a unified front to provide the best possible care and opportunities for Jacob. This also allows the IEP goals to be implemented in the home setting, not just at school, especially the goals related to occupational therapy, physical therapy, and speech therapy. Educators play a large role in supporting children with disabilities. Ken specified that the most effective thing an educator can do to support his son is to listen. He said that educators need to listen to the parents and implement strategies and processes that the parents desire for their child.
